5. Please select your rank.

Choose one of the following answers

Please choose only one of the following:

  • OR2 - Able Rate, Private, Air Specialist
  • OR3 - Lance Corporal
  • OR4 - Leading Hand, Corporal
  • OR6 - Petty Officer, Sergeant
  • OR7 - Chief Petty Officer, Staff Sergeant, Flight Sergeant
  • OR8 - Warrant Officer 2, Warrant Officer Class 2
  • OR9 - Warrant Officer 1, Warrant Officer Class 1, Warrant Officer
  • OF1 - Midshipman, Second Lieutenant, Pilot Officer
  • OF1 - Sub Lieutenant, Lieutenant, Flying Officer
  • OF2 - Lieutenant, Captain, Flight Lieutenant
  • OF3 - Lieutenant Commander, Major, Squadron Leader
  • OF4 - Commander, Lieutenant Colonel, Wing Commander
  • OF5 - Captain, Colonel, Group Captain
  • OF6 - Commodore, Brigadier, Air Commodore
  • OF7 - Rear Admiral, Major General, Air Vice-Marshal
  • OF8 - Vice Admiral, Lieutenant General, Air Marshal
  • OF9 - Admiral, General, Air Chief Marshal
